The government publishes 3 different public report surgical site infection (SSI) metrics, all called standardized infection ratios (SIRs), that impact perceived hospital quality. We conducted a non-random cross-sectional observational pilot study of 20 California hospitals that voluntarily submitted colon surgery and SSI data. Discordant SIR values, leading to contradictory conclusions, occurred in 35% of these hospitals.Infect Control Hosp Epidemiol2016;1–5

Surgical site infection (SSI) surveillance techniques for colon surgery and hysterectomy among Colorado infection preventionists were characterized through an online survey. Considerable variation was found in SSI surveillance practices, specifically varying use of triggers for SSI review, including laboratory values, healthcare personnel communication, and postoperative visits.Infect Control Hosp Epidemiol 2014;00(0): 1–3

Objective: To study nosocomial infections and identify the main agents causing hospital infections at Hue University Hospital. Subjects and Methods: A cross-sectional descriptive study of 385 patients with surgical interventions. Results: The prevalence of hospital infections was 5.2%, surgical site infection was the most common (60%), followed by skin and soft tissue infections (35%), urinary tract infections (5%). Surgical site infection (11.6%) in dirty surgery. There were 3 bacterial pathogens isolated, including Staphylococcus aureus (50%), Pseudomonas aeruginosa and Enterococcusspp (25%). Conclusion: Surgical site infection was high in hospital-acquired infections. Key words: hospital infections, surgical intervention, surgical site infection, bacteria

ABSTRACT Objective: To describe the profile of women in relation to their living conditions, health status and socio-demographic profile, correlating it with the presence of signs and symptoms suggestive of post-cesarean surgical site infection, identifying information to be considered in the puerperium consultation performed by nurses and proposing a roadmap for the systematization of care. Method: Quantitative, exploratory, descriptive, cross-sectional and retrospective review of medical records of women who had cesarean deliveries in 2014, in the city of São Paulo. Results: 89 medical records were analyzed, 62 of them with incomplete information. In 11, there was at least one of the signs and symptoms suggestive of infection. Conclusion: Given the results of the study, the systematization of puerperal consultation is essential. The roadmap is an instrument that can potentially improve the quality of service and the recording of information.

<p>Introducción: La infección de sitio quirúrgico (ISQ) es la infección intrahospitalaria más frecuente en los pacientes quirúrgicos con una incidencia entre 5-30%. Objetivos: Identificar los factores de riesgo para ISQ en cirugía colónica en nuestra población. Los objetivos secundarios son determinar la incidencia y tipo de ISQ, así como la incidencia de dehiscencia de anastomosis (DA). Materiales y métodos: Estudio de casos-controles de pacientes intervenidos de colectomía entre 2010-2014 en el Hospital Privado Universitario de Córdoba y Hospital Raúl Ferreyra. Se incluyeron las intervenciones convencionales y laparoscópicas, con seguimiento de 30 días, pacientes entre 20 y 85 años y con ASA I-III. Se excluyeron las cirugías de urgencia y las resecciones recto-anales. Se definió ISQ a aquella que ocurre dentro de 30 días. Resultados: Se incluyeron 238 pacientes. Se diagnosticó ISQ en 27,7% (n=66) de los pacientes de los cuales 12,2% fue superficial, 4,6% profunda y 10,9% de órgano/espacio. El análisis multivariado demostró que la ISQ se asocia con sexo masculino (odds ratio [OR] 3,15; IC95%:1,43-6,92; p=0,004), quimioterapia neoadyuvante (OR 6,72; IC95%:1,48-30,93; p=0,01), conversión (OR 3,32; IC95%:1,13-9,77; p=0,02), reintervención dentro de 30 días postquirúrgicos (OR 12,34; IC95%:2,65-57,37, p=0,001) y DA (OR 12,83; IC95%:2,97- 55,5; p=0,001). La DA presenta una incidencia del 9,6%, de los cuales el 91% presentó ISQ y todas fueron de órgano/espacio. Conclusión: Sexo masculino, quimioterapia neoadyuvante, conversión, reintervención dentro de 30 días postquirúrgicos y DA son factores de riesgo para ISQ en nuestra población. Estos resultados deben ser considerados para implementar medidas preventivas para ISQ.</p>

Surgical Site Infection is infections that occur after surgery. Control of the incidence of nosocomial infection is part of the parameters of good health services at the hospital. One in 10 mothers who give birth by cesarean has an infection. The level of patient knowledge about how to care for wounds is an important factor in decreasing the incidence of wound infection in the surgical area in SC patients. Objective: knowing the relationship between levels of knowledge of post-operative SC patients about wound care and the incidence of surgical site wound infections. Method: The design used descriptive correlative and cross sectional approach. The sample were 76 respondents. The data were collected in December 2019 by using a knowledge level questionnaire and a form of signs of infection from Morison 2004. Data analysis using chi square).  The results showed that there was a relationship between knowledge and the incidence of infection in the area of ​​operation (p value 0.001).  Keywords: nosocomial, surgical site infection (SSI), section caesarea (SC)

Objective: Description of knowledge on prevention of surgical site infections (SSIs) among medical staff in Son Tay general hospital, 2021 and some related factors.Method: A cross-sectional study was conducted on 151 medical staff.Results: The rate of medical staff with fully knowledge of SSI prevention is 36.42%, in which the rate of doctors is 38.3% and of nurses is 35.58%. Age group ≥30 (OR=2.82; 95%CI: 1.12 – 7.13);Department of Surgery (OR=13.61; 95%CI: 5.14 – 35.98); working year ≥10 (OR=2.54; 95%CI: 1.26 – 5.11) and number of patients cared for/day <8 (OR=3.43; 95%CI: 1.26 – 9 ,34) are factorsrelated to the knowledge of medical staff about regarding SSIs.Conclusion: The medical staff’s knowledge of surgical site infection prevention is suboptimal; relevant factors should be considered when conducting ongoing training in the prevention of surgical site infections in hospitals.

Background: Appendectomy is the most commonly performed emergency  surgical procedure and has significant morbidity of surgical site infection (SSIs). Regarding this, there are conflicting reports and dilemma on use of optimal duration of antibiotics. The aim of this study was to evaluate the incidence of SSIs after three doses of perioperative prophylactic antibiot­ics (single dose before surgery and two doses postoperatively) after ap­pendectomy in acute non- perforated appendicitis (NPA). Methods: This cross sectional study was conducted in the department of General surgery, Chitwan Medical College Teaching Hospital, from May 2018 to April 2019. All the cases received single dose of antibiotics (cef­triaxone and metronidazole) during the induction of anesthesia and two doses of the same antibiotics postoperatively within 24 hours. SSIs was assessed on 2nd and followed up till 7th postoperative day. The data col­lected was analyzed using SPSS version 16. Results: In the study of 100 patients, who received perioperative three doses of antibiotics, the overall frequency of SSIs on 2nd and 3rd post-operative day were 2% (p=.840) and 6% (p=.539) respectively, which was statistically not significant. In follow up after 3rd postoperative day, there was no evidence of SSIs. Statistically there was no significant difference in the incidence and grade of SSIs between age group, sex and duration of operation. Conclusions: A combined three doses of perioperative antibiotics was ad­equate for SSIs prevention in patients of any age group and sex with acute NPA after appendectomy in usual operative time.

Abstract Purposes Surgical site infection (SSI) after colorectal surgery is a frequent complication associated with the increase in morbidity, medical expenses, and mortality. To date, there is no nationwide large-scale database of SSI after colorectal surgery in China. The aim of this study was to determine the incidence of SSI after colorectal surgery in China and to further evaluate the related risk factors. Methods Two multicenter, prospective, cross-sectional studies covering 55 hospitals in China and enrolling adult patients undergoing colorectal surgery were conducted from May 1 to June 30 of 2018 and the same time of 2019. The demographic and perioperative characteristics were collected, and the main outcome was SSI within postoperative 30 days. Multivariable logistic regressions were conducted to predict risk factors of SSI after colorectal surgery. Results In total, 1046 patients were enrolled and SSI occurred in 74 patients (7.1%). In the multivariate analysis with adjustments, significant factors associated with SSI were the prior diagnosis of hypertension (OR, 1.903; 95% confidence interval [CI], 1.088–3.327, P = 0.025), national nosocomial infection surveillance risk index score of 2 or 3 (OR, 3.840; 95% CI, 1.926–7.658, P < 0.001), laparoscopic or robotic surgery (OR, 0.363; 95% CI, 0.200–0.659, P < 0.001), and adhesive incise drapes (OR, 0.400; 95% CI, 0.187–0.855, P = 0.018). In addition, SSI group had remarkably increased length of postoperative stays (median, 15.0 d versus 9.0d, P < 0.001), medical expenses (median, 74,620 yuan versus 57,827 yuan, P < 0.001), and the mortality (4.1% versus 0.3%, P = 0.006), compared with those of non-SSI group. Conclusion This study provides the newest data of SSI after colorectal surgery in China and finds some predictors of SSI. The data presented in our study can be a tool to develop optimal preventive measures and improve surgical quality in China.
